GrantedLicense - AWS License Manager

GrantedLicense

Describes a license that is granted to a grantee.

Contents

Beneficiary

Granted license beneficiary.

Type: String

Required: No

ConsumptionConfiguration

Configuration for consumption of the license.

Type: ConsumptionConfiguration object

Required: No

CreateTime

Creation time of the granted license.

Type: String

Length Constraints: Maximum length of 50.

Pattern: ^(-?(?:[1-9][0-9]*)?[0-9]{4})-(1[0-2]|0[1-9])-(3[0-1]|0[1-9]|[1-2][0-9])T(2[0-3]|[0-1][0-9]):([0-5][0-9]):([0-5][0-9])(\.[0-9]+)?(Z|[+-](?:2[ 0-3]|[0-1][0-9]):[0-5][0-9])+$

Required: No

Entitlements

License entitlements.

Type: Array of Entitlement objects

Required: No

HomeRegion

Home Region of the granted license.

Type: String

Required: No

Issuer

Granted license issuer.

Type: IssuerDetails object

Required: No

LicenseArn

Amazon Resource Name (ARN) of the license.

Type: String

Length Constraints: Maximum length of 2048.

Pattern: ^arn:aws(-(cn|us-gov|iso-b|iso-c|iso-d))?:[A-Za-z0-9][A-Za-z0-9_/.-]{0,62}:[A-Za-z0-9_/.-]{0,63}:[A-Za-z0-9_/.-]{0,63}:[A-Za-z0-9][A-Za-z0-9:_/+=,@.-]{0,1023}$

Required: No

LicenseMetadata

Granted license metadata.

Type: Array of Metadata objects

Required: No

LicenseName

License name.

Type: String

Required: No

ProductName

Product name.

Type: String

Required: No

ProductSKU

Product SKU.

Type: String

Required: No

ReceivedMetadata

Granted license received metadata.

Type: ReceivedMetadata object

Required: No

Status

Granted license status.

Type: String

Valid Values: AVAILABLE | PENDING_AVAILABLE | DEACTIVATED | SUSPENDED | EXPIRED | PENDING_DELETE | DELETED

Required: No

Validity

Date and time range during which the granted license is valid, in ISO8601-UTC format.

Type: DatetimeRange object

Required: No

Version

Version of the granted license.

Type: String

Required: No

See Also

For more information about using this API in one of the language-specific AWS SDKs, see the following: